1. PHP / Говнокод #12331

    +54

    1. 01
    2. 02
    3. 03
    4. 04
    5. 05
    6. 06
    7. 07
    8. 08
    9. 09
    10. 10
    11. 11
    12. 12
    13. 13
    function bezpezdu_num($num)
    {
    	if(isset($num) && !empty($num) && is_numeric($num))
    		return true;
    	else
    		return false;
    }
    
    function pizdec($text)
    {
    	$showtext = htmlspecialchars($text);
    	exit($showtext);
    }

    $app->run_epta();

    Запостил: kindofbear, 21 Декабря 2012

    Комментарии (12) RSS

    • $this->processPizdaNoga()->perekusiMenyaZubastayaAkula();
      Ответить
    • "Ну хоть как-нибудь запустись, а?"
      Ответить
    • Гыгы, матюки в коде. Смешно.
      Ответить
      • Здесь ресурс smichnoykod.ru? Я вообще-то постил потому, что код не очень
        Ответить
        • Да, код действительно говно. С точки зрения bezpezdu_num ноль не является числом, ибо нехуй empty вернёт false.
          По этой причине вставить жирный нолик в комментарии к ГК задача нетривиальная.
          Ответить
          • Собственно, поэтому и не понимаю почему этот экземпляр и еще два ниже минусуют. В случае перенаправления есть такая штука как header, в случае подергаться - там вообще ад, даже комментарии не нужны. День минусов, не иначе.
            Ответить
    • О как, а exit в пыхе принимает строку?
      P.S. Почитал ман, да, принимает.
      exit("<script type='text/javascript'>alert('Pizdec.')</script>");
      Ответить
      • die('<html><body><h1>Title</h1><br />Some text here.</body></html>');
        Ответить
    • if(is_numeric((int)$num))
      Ответить
      • В таком случае if и is_numeric можно опустить и оставить только приведение.
        Ответить
    • И вывод "Потрачено";
      Ответить

    Добавить комментарий